Making Grilled Cheese for a Crowd, Step By Step
Step #1
Set up broiler so that the rack is 7-8 inches from the heat source. Put the bread on a large baking sheet in a single layer.

Step #2
Spray the bread with butter flavored cooking spray (you can absolutely use softened butter spread onto the bread instead. The spray is just faster).

Step #3
Put the pan of bread under the broiler until toasted.

See how toasty?

Step #4
Flip the bread slices over.

Step #5
Top each slice of bread with shredded cheese.

Step #6
Return it to under the broiler until the cheese melts. Mmmm… broiled cheese.

Step #7
Top cheese with additional slices of bread.

Step #8
Spray with cooking spray.

Step #9
Put it back under the broiler until toasted.

Step #10
Cut sandwiches in half.

Step #11
Serve!

Broiled Grilled Cheese For a Crowd Recipe
Learn how to use your broiler to whip up a big batch of grilled cheese sandwiches for a crowd with little fuss. You’re not going to believe how quick and easy this is.
- Prep Time: 5 minutes
- Cook Time: 6 minutes
- Total Time: 11 minutes
- Yield: 6 servings 1x
- Category: Entrée
- Method: Baked
- Cuisine: American
Ingredients
- 12 slices of bread
- butter-flavored cooking spray (or softened butter)
- 1 and 1/2 cups finely shredded cheese
Instructions
- Set up broiler so that the rack is 7-8 inches from the heat source.
- Put the bread on a large baking sheet in a single layer. Spray the bread with cooking spray (you can absolutely use softened butter spread onto the bread instead. The spray is just faster). Put the pan of bread under the broiler until toasted.
- Flip the bread slices over. Top each slice of bread with shredded cheese, spreading it around to cover the bread. Return pan to under the broiler until the cheese melts.
- Top cheese with additional slices of bread. Spray tops of bread with cooking spray. Put it back under the broiler until toasted.
- Cut sandwiches in half. Serve!
